The Experience in Detail

Cancun Combo Tour: Zipline and Off-Road Buggy Adventure - The Experience in Detail

Starting Point: Convenient Pickup and Safety Briefing

Your adventure kicks off with a comfortable, air-conditioned minivan pickup from your Cancun hotel. This transport option is a highlight for travelers wanting a hassle-free start, as most reviews mention punctual pickups and friendly guides. Once at the park, you’ll receive a thorough safety briefing—crucial for the zipline segments and buggy rides—making sure even nervous first-timers feel prepared.

The Zipline Circuit: Soaring Over the Jungle

The highlight of most reviews is the 12 cables suspended over the treetops, stretching over 1.5 miles (2.4 km) of track. Our sources mention that the zipline course is planned for adrenaline and fun, with some reviewers noting the chance to go upside down, adding a bit of daring to the experience. The cables are described as “colossal,” giving a real sense of scale and adventure.

What the Tour Includes and What to Consider

Cancun Combo Tour: Zipline and Off-Road Buggy Adventure - What the Tour Includes and What to Consider

What’s Included

  • Professional guides who are knowledgeable and attentive
  • All necessary equipment for ziplining and buggy riding
  • A light lunch with authentic dishes
  • Access to 4 aerial bridges, the zipline circuit, and cenote swim
  • Use of all safety gear

Additional Costs and Considerations

  • Transportation from your hotel costs around $10-15 USD**, depending on your zone.
  • Lockers are not included, so plan to store valuables securely.
  • ATV Collision and Damage Insurance is not covered, so consider whether you want to purchase extra coverage if available.
  • Physical fitness is recommended, as activities involve climbing, balancing, and driving.
  • Age and weight restrictions: Minimum age of 8 to participate, with drivers needing to be at least 16 with valid ID. Max weight for ziplining is 150kg/330lb, and waist circumference should not exceed 120cm/47 inches.

FAQs

Cancun Combo Tour: Zipline and Off-Road Buggy Adventure - FAQs

Is transportation from Cancun included in the price?
Transportation is not included but can be arranged at an additional cost of around $10-15 USD depending on your location. The tour provides round-trip transport, making logistics easier for travelers.

How long does the tour last?
The tour lasts approximately 4 hours 30 minutes, which makes it a great half-day activity that leaves you plenty of time to explore other parts of Cancun or relax afterward.

What is the minimum age to participate?
Participants must be at least 8 years old to join, making it suitable for families with older children.

Are all activities suitable for beginners?
Yes, guides provide safety instructions, and all necessary equipment is supplied. However, some activities like ziplining and ATV riding require a reasonable level of physical fitness and comfort with heights and speed.

Do I need to bring my own gear?
No, all safety gear and necessary equipment are provided as part of the tour. Just bring comfortable clothing and closed shoes suitable for outdoor activity.

What should I wear and bring?
Light, breathable clothing, sunscreen, a hat, and waterproof camera or phone case are recommended. Swimsuits if you plan to swim in the cenote.

Is the tour suitable for people with mobility issues?
The activities involve walking, climbing, and driving on uneven terrain, so those with mobility challenges might find it difficult to participate fully.
